A Space for Systems and Stories

Welcome to ToyBox Insights, the place where systems meet stories.

If you know me, you know I’ve spent the better part of two decades living in the intersection of structure and soul. My work has carried me from YMCA aquatics decks to C-suites, from city council chambers to cultural campaigns, from rebuilding $12M operations to coaching first-time board members.

Across it all, one truth has been constant: strategy only matters if it can be practiced.

This blog is where I put that truth into action. It’s a working library—part playbook, part journal, part toolkit. A space where I can share what works, what I’ve learned, and what leaders like you can adapt in your own organizations.

Why Insights, Not Articles

The internet is overflowing with articles that promise quick fixes and “10 hacks to…” everything under the sun. That’s not what you’ll find here.

I named this space Insights for a reason. Each post is designed to do one of three things:

  1. Offer a tested framework or tool you can use immediately.

  2. Reflect on leadership in practice, weaving in both successes and stumbles.

  3. Translate complexity into clarity, so you can see your own next step more clearly.

I’m not interested in flooding your inbox with fluff. I am interested in building a resource that leaders can return to whenever they need grounding—or a spark.

Who This Blog Is For

  • Nonprofit leaders trying to stabilize systems, prepare for compliance, or strengthen boards.

  • Small business owners who want to grow without losing their sanity.

  • Civic partners and investors who want to understand how ToyBox creates value and manages complexity.

  • Creative entrepreneurs who see systems not as constraints, but as launchpads for their ideas.

If you see yourself in one of these groups, you’re in the right place. And even if you don’t, my hope is that something here resonates with the way you move through the world.

What You’ll Find Here

Think of Insights as a library with four wings:

  1. Playbooks & Templates — Board agendas, grant readiness checklists, governance policies, and more.

  2. Event Toolkits — Sponsorship tiers, vendor matrices, and run-of-show guides drawn from real campaigns.

  3. Mindfulness in the Middle — A reflection series on leadership, balance, and the human side of systems.

  4. Case Spotlights — Anonymized examples showing how messy problems became measurable wins.

Together, these categories create a balance of practical, strategic, and reflective content—because real leadership requires all three.
